M. Kadri Altundağ is a scholar working on Oncology, Pathology and Forensic Medicine and Epidemiology. According to data from OpenAlex, M. Kadri Altundağ has authored 29 papers receiving a total of 281 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Oncology, 9 papers in Pathology and Forensic Medicine and 7 papers in Epidemiology. Recurrent topics in M. Kadri Altundağ’s work include Breast Cancer Treatment Studies (5 papers), Cancer Treatment and Pharmacology (4 papers) and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(3 papers). M. Kadri Altundağ is often cited by papers focused on Breast Cancer Treatment Studies (5 papers), Cancer Treatment and Pharmacology (4 papers) and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(3 papers). M. Kadri Altundağ collaborates with scholars based in Türkiye, United States and Belgium. M. Kadri Altundağ's co-authors include Yavuz Özışık, İbrahim Güllü, Sıddika Songül Yalçın, Faruk Zorlu, Fadıl Akyol, Enis Özyar, Mustafa Cengiz, Saadettin Kılıçkap, İ. Lale Atahan and Yasemin Özdamar and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, Cancer and Spine.
